Re: Availability of pg_backend_pid() immediately after connection establishment

From: "Magnus Hagander" <mha(at)sollentuna(dot)net>
To: "Hari Bhaskaran" <hbhaskaran(at)gmail(dot)com>, <pgsql-general(at)postgresql(dot)org>
Subject: Re: Availability of pg_backend_pid() immediately after connection establishment
Date: 2006-11-02 09:39:06
Message-ID: 6BCB9D8A16AC4241919521715F4D8BCEA35893@algol.sollentuna.se
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-general

> Someone in this group mentioned a while back that
> pg_backend_pid() function works only after some 1/2 second
> after the connection has been established. This had
> something to do with the stats collector to make its sweep
> every .5 seconds?. Does anyone have more information on this?

No, pg_backend_pid() returns MyProcPid, which is set on backend startup.

However, the different pg_stat_* views won't work until a message has
been passed down to the stats collector, that is correct.

//Magnus

In response to

Responses

Browse pgsql-general by date

  From Date Subject
Next Message tomas 2006-11-02 10:00:15 Re: [HACKERS] Index greater than 8k
Previous Message Richard Huxton 2006-11-02 09:30:05 Re: time value '24:00:00'